For over one hundred years, Cotter High School has provided young women and men from Winona and the surrounding areas with a challenging liberal arts education, grounded in Catholic faith and values. From its small beginnings with 11 graduates to its highest enrollment in the mid 1960's to today, Cotter High School and Junior High have maintained the highest academic standards while imparting Catholic faith and values to generations of local and international students. Bishop Cotter died in 1909, and, in 1911, his successor, Bishop Patrick Heffron, dedicated Cotter School for Boys and named it for Bishop Cotter. Cotter High School for Boys began in a small school building on the east end of Winona, Minnesota, on September 5, 1911.
